It’s finally here! The time of year when it becomes perfectly acceptable to take your socks off in public and show your pale toes to the world. It’s the season of sun, seaside and, inevitably, sandals. So this Tuesday Shoesday I wanted to show you my new favourite summer shoes and to challenge you to guess what brand they are.tuesday shoesday shoe fashion ideas for summer 2015 crocs sandals from flip flop shop-10I wrote about the jelly shoes trend last year after WGSN predicted an increase in rubber footwear and have reminisced about really wanting a pair when I was a child. Now that the trend has come full-circle, jelly shoes are finally in fashion again and I’ve seen hundreds of styles available on the high street. The only problem has been that modern jelly shoes are not quite as comfortable as I remember them being in childhood. In truth, all the ones I’ve tried on have been rather plasticy and unyielding so they will inevitably rub my toes and blister my heels. Which is why I have resisted buying any. Until now.tuesday shoesday shoe fashion ideas for summer 2015 crocs sandals from flip flop shop-6I picked up these gorgeous brightly coloured jelly sandals from Flip Flop Shop and they have transformed my summer wardrobe. Not only are they the cutest summer sandals I’ve ever seen, but they are also the most comfortable. The straps stretch a little, which make them easy to get on while keeping the shoes firmly strapped to my foot – I never feel like they are about to flop off at any moment! tuesday shoesday shoe fashion ideas for summer 2015 crocs sandals-3The rubber sole is also really flexible and when I walk on them my feet feel cushioned. There’s definitely an element of bounce-back from the rubber so they are really comfortable on the soles and I can wear them all day without my feet getting tired. Whether you’re walking around a seaside town, strolling along the promenade, playing in the sand or running into the sea, these sandals will stay put and keep your feet comfortable. tuesday shoesday shoe fashion ideas for summer 2015 crocs sandals from flip flop shop-9 Oh wait. I still haven’t told you what brand these are yet. They are Crocs. This really surprised me because I picked them out based on their bright go-with-everything colours before I even looked at the brand. After double-checking that these aren’t clogs – they are the Huarache flat sandal style – I realised that the Crocs design is probably what makes these sandals so comfortable. Plus, the pretty styling has definitely made Crocs more accessible for an older audience.
